The Role
Lead flight test engineering for aircraft subsystems: plan, integrate, verify/validate, perform risk and trade studies, resolve complex electrical and embedded software issues, evaluate airworthiness and cybersecurity of modifications, and develop failure modes and test requirements.
Summary Generated by Built In
- Perform technical planning, subsystem integration, verification and validation, risk analyses, and supportability and effectiveness analyses for major subsystems or components
- Apply intensive and diverse knowledge to resolve complex design issues that have a significant impact to the program or task area
- Perform analyses for one or more subsystems to include concept, design, fabrication, test, integration, installation, operation, maintenance and disposal
- Ensure the logical and systematic conversion of subsystem and associated interface requirements into solutions that acknowledge technical, schedule, and cost constraints; identify and quantify associated risks
- Perform subsystem architectural analysis, functional analysis, timeline analysis, detailed trade studies, requirements allocation and interface definition studies to translate subsystem requirements into hardware and/or software specifications and develop failure modes and effects testing requirements for critical software threads
- Provide a consistently high level of flight test engineering expertise and maintain proficiency in developing aircraft deficiency corrections
- Ensure all safety requirements are met during testing, when recommending improvements, or noting deficiencies
- Provide technical expertise in solving complex electrical and software engineering problems
- Perform independent review of problems and develop solutions to support efficient workflow and increased situational awareness for aircrew
- Evaluate Airworthiness and cyber-security of aircraft modifications using data analysis and extraction tools for independent verification and validation of embedded software systems and data interfaces
- Other duties as assigned
